Product Description:
The DDC01.1-K200A-DC04-01-FW is a digital intelligent servo drive from Bosch Rexroth Indramat in the DDC Digital Intelligent Servo Drives series. It is used on automated machinery to supply speed- and torque-controlled power to synchronous motors in production lines. The drive includes an INTERBUS-S command module for fieldbus communication and uses digital servo feedback from the motor for closed-loop regulation. This combination allows the controller and motor to exchange command and feedback data while maintaining precise speed and torque response during changing load conditions.
The unit delivers a maximum armature current of 200 A, while its continuous current limit is 45 A under natural-convection cooling. During steady operation, it supports a continuous mechanical load of 7.5 kW, yet the electronics can provide up to 33 kW for short overloads. A power supply rated at 22.5 kVA is required for this operating range. S6-100 s duty permits 90 A with 15 kW of mechanical output, which gives the drive extra short-term capacity for acceleration or brief process peaks. Internally, the PWM inverter switches at 4 kHz and dissipates 500 W of heat to the surrounding air. Noise emission is standard for the 100 A to 200 A operating range, and the drive is function code 04, version 01, in Series 1, Version 1.
Braking energy is handled by a bleeder circuit rated for 0.25 kW continuously and up to 40 kW during short deceleration peaks, with an energy limit of 20 kWs. This arrangement helps control DC-bus voltage during rapid stops and supports short braking events without an external resistor. The housing is sealed to IP65, which protects the electronics against dust ingress and low-pressure water jets. An internal power-loss monitor works with the switching stage to manage thermal loading during cyclic duty. This helps the power section remain stable when the connected axis is repeatedly accelerating, running at speed, and slowing to a stop.
